Tab Group Switch is a browser extension that allows users to easily organize open browser tabs into labeled groups. It helps manage a large number of open tabs by collapsing them into a sidebar.
Conex is an open-source low-code application development platform that allows users to quickly build custom web and mobile applications. It features a drag-and-drop interface to design application workflows and integrate with databases and APIs.
